Output 901b5d362380fc3287b28d14c8a5988ee21bd3e603f4e26a3dc7379258ee2c77:1

value
602586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b912a80abd1e970ec4dbc98d9721df4aefc405d OP_EQUAL
address
38aaWF4qhqoCcy1DPz2WMLMNvptJoTYHwB
transaction
901b5d362380fc3287b28d14c8a5988ee21bd3e603f4e26a3dc7379258ee2c77
spent
true